Santander Portugal is looking for a **Credit Risk Support Intern** based in **Lisbon**.
We are **redefining how we work**, through innovation, cutting-edge technology, collaboration, and the freedom to explore new ideas. In this role, you will have the opportunity to collaborate across areas related to Credit Risk, supporting control, monitoring, reporting, auditing, and continuous improvement initiatives—contributing to the quality, efficiency, and robustness of the Bank’s risk processes.
You will work closely with various Risk teams, corporate functions, and internal stakeholders, gaining a comprehensive understanding of the Bank’s operations and key risk management processes.
To succeed in this role, you will be responsible for:
* Supporting the execution of periodic controls and risk monitoring activities related to Credit Risk processes;
* Collaborating in the preparation and analysis of management information, performance indicators, and internal reports;
* Participating in the collection, validation, and processing of information from different areas of the Bank;
* Supporting initiatives related to internal and external audits, ensuring proper organization and availability of required information;
* Contributing to the identification of opportunities for process improvement and automation;
* Participating in cross-functional projects impacting risk management and control.
